Artificial fill (Holocene)—Mud, sand, and gravel of varying proportions, possibly including foreign debris such as concrete, logs, timbers, or brick. Used for highway roadbeds and other construction. Thickness generally greater than 2 m. Mapped where fill substantially obscures or has altered original geologic deposit. Colic (abdominal pain), caused from the accumulation of sand and small pieces of gravel in the large colon, continues to be a problem for horses. In one study, of the cases of colic with an identifiable cause, 5% of the reported colic cases were due to sand.
